, established in 1895, is a comprehensive institution offering undergraduate and graduate programs in a chiropractic studies. The graduate program at CMCC offers several specializations including clinical sciences, sports sciences and more. In the undergraduate program, Canadian Chiropractic College students can study chiropractic studies, radiology, clinical diagnosis and more.
The Canadian
Memorial Chiropractic College is located in the city of Toronto, in the province of Ontario in
canada. The scenic campus offers numerous state-of-the-art facilities that students can take advantage of. Among them are the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College Library, which offers numerous books, journals and additional resources accessible to students. Other facilities at Canadian Chiropractic include a student clinics, research facilities and much more.
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College also offers numerous clubs and organizations on campus including Canadian Council of Women Chiropractors, the Thompson Technique Club, the Dragon Boat Club and many others.

Quick Facts:
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College is accredited by the Canadian Federation of Chiropractic Regulatory and Educational Accrediting Boards.
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College offers numerous financial aid options for students include scholarships, students loans and more.
According to the United States Department of Labor Bureau of Labor Statistics "employment of chiropractors is expected to grow faster than average in the years 2006-16."
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College does not offer on campus housing, but offers some housing location assistance.
Through the numerous students clinics on campus and in the surrounding area, students will have the opportunity to gain practical hands on experience in their field.
The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College offers many benefits to students including counseling service, academic advising and more.
Students at the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College will be able to take advantage of experienced faculty.
Canadian Memorial Chiropractic College offer numerous continuing education programs including an acupuncture certificate program, weekend seminars, distance education programs and more.
